Transaction 29e812f977888c35686966aef2a4e4cac37fc80eb2b13c4af56de801de8a5f65

1 Input
2 Outputs
  • 29e812f977888c35686966aef2a4e4cac37fc80eb2b13c4af56de801de8a5f65:0
  • value  25354220
    address  3BMEXXB3KPPobpyy4Hefczwf7kss13asyC
  • 29e812f977888c35686966aef2a4e4cac37fc80eb2b13c4af56de801de8a5f65:1
  • value  1408134881
    address  1JcAs82Vk9qoAjewtfTj43BkRctg3cA7Hx